4L8C

Crystal structure of the H2Db in complex with the NP-N3D peptide

Experimental procedure
Experimental methodSINGLE WAVELENGTH
Source typeSYNCHROTRON
Source detailsAUSTRALIAN SYNCHROTRON BEAMLINE MX2
Synchrotron siteAustralian Synchrotron
BeamlineMX2
Temperature [K]100
Detector technologyCCD
Collection date2012-04-17
DetectorADSC QUANTUM 315r
Wavelength(s)0.956
Spacegroup nameP 1 21 1
Unit cell lengths81.567, 85.464, 138.506
Unit cell angles90.00, 90.18, 90.00
Refinement procedure
Resolution59.010 - 2.800
R-factor0.1894
Rwork0.186
R-free0.25840
Structure solution methodMOLECULAR REPLACEMENT
Starting model (for MR)4huu
RMSD bond length0.010
RMSD bond angle1.190
Data scaling softwareSCALA (3.3.12)
Phasing softwarePHASER
Refinement softwareBUSTER-TNT
Data quality characteristics
 OverallOuter shell
Low resolution limit [Å]138.5052.950
High resolution limit [Å]2.8002.800
Rmerge0.604
Number of reflections47116
<I/σ(I)>2.3
Completeness [%]99.9100
Redundancy3.83.8
Crystallization Conditions
crystal IDmethodpHtemperaturedetails
1VAPOR DIFFUSION, HANGING DROP8.52980.1 M Tris-HCl, pH 8.5, 0.2 M lithium sulfate, 25-30% PEG8000, VAPOR DIFFUSION, HANGING DROP, temperature 298K
